About this experience
Spend 2 hours onboard a first-class vessel while cruising along the Sydney Harbour and enjoying buffet lunch with refreshments (tea, coffee, water) . Along the way, you will discover some of the city's most iconic landmarks, including the Sydney Harbour Bridge, Opera House, and Sydney Botanical Gardens. Get to know Sydney better with the help of an educated live commentator, who will provide insights into the history of the city.
